Rast Gets Ivey to Muck
Level 2
Pot-Limit Omaha
Brian Rast opened to 1,200 on the button, and Phil Ivey defended his big blind. The two saw a flop, and Ivey check-called 1,800. Rast upped the stakes to 5,000 on the turn, but Ivey was undeterred. On the river, the action really picked up, with Ivey check-raising to 30,000 after Rast fired 11,500. Rast took his time, thinking for awhile before tossing in a raise to 85,000. Now it was Ivey's turn to tank. After a few minutes of cutting chips, he ducked his head flicked his cards into the muck.
Rast has already claimed one win in this event, taking it down in 2011 for $1.7 million. He's off to a good start on his quest for number two.
